The most common reasons a BMW 320i AC isn't working are a refrigerant leak, an electrical climate control issue, or a problem with the air conditioning compressor.
  • Refrigerant Leak: A refrigerant leak can occur due to damaged hoses, seals, or connections, resulting in decreased cooling efficiency in the air conditioning system.
  • Climate Control Electrical Issue: A faulty climate control module or a blown fuse could be causing the electrical issues in the climate control system.
  • AC Compressor: A faulty AC compressor may be due to a lack of lubrication, electrical issues, or internal mechanical failure, resulting in inadequate cooling performance.

Troubleshooting AC Issues in a BMW 320i

When troubleshooting AC issues in your BMW 320i, begin by checking the most accessible components to identify potential problems. Start with the refrigerant levels, as low refrigerant is a common culprit for warm air blowing from the vents. If the levels are low, consider recharging the system. Next, inspect the air filters; a clogged or dirty filter can restrict airflow and diminish cooling efficiency. If these initial checks do not resolve the issue, examine the compressor and electrical connections for any signs of malfunction. Ensure that the Climate Control settings are correctly adjusted and that the engine is running while you perform these diagnostics. If the problem persists after these steps, it may be necessary to delve deeper into the system, checking the condenser and evaporator for blockages or damage. What Are the Common Causes of AC Failure in a BMW 320i?

Understanding the common causes of AC failure in a BMW 320i is essential for any DIY enthusiast looking to maintain their vehicle's comfort. One of the primary culprits is low refrigerant levels, which can significantly hinder the AC's ability to cool the air effectively. If you notice that your AC isn't blowing cold air, checking the refrigerant level should be your first step. Another frequent issue is a faulty compressor; if the compressor is malfunctioning, it won't circulate the refrigerant properly, leading to inadequate cooling. Electrical problems can also arise, as the AC system relies on various electrical components that may fail over time. Additionally, clogged or dirty air filters can restrict airflow, making the AC work harder and less efficiently. Lastly, issues with the condenser or evaporator can also contribute to AC failure, as these components are crucial for the heat exchange process.
